The family unit need not be confined to the marital relationship

For the children's and fathers' rights in Ireland Posted on 23/11/2020 by admin23/11/2020

In 1994 in Keegan v. Ireland, the European Court of Human Rights noted that the family unit need not be confined to the marital relationship to enjoy protection but that a de facto family existed and enjoyed protection as well … Continue reading →

Parental Alienation – European Court of Human Rights decision

For the children's and fathers' rights in Ireland Posted on 23/11/2020 by admin25/11/2020

The recent decision of the European Court of Human Rights in Pisică v Republic of Moldova has addressed procedural delay, an issue that unfortunately features in almost every alienation or high conflict case, which compounds destruction in already fraught circumstances. … Continue reading →
